Detailed Feature Comparison
| Feature | Nationwide Life Insurance Company | United States Life Insurance (Corebridge) |
|---|---|---|
| Founded | 1929 | 1850 |
| Headquarters | Columbus, Ohio | New York, NY |
| Assets Under Management | $140 billion | $393 billion consolidated |
| Years in IUL Business | 15+ years | 10+ years |
| Number of IUL Products | 2 | 2 |
| Typical Cap Rate Range | 9.5% - 25% | 8% - 10% |
| Participation Rates | 200% | 110% |
| Minimum Premium | $5,000 annual | $5,000 annual |
| Issue Ages | 0-85 years | 0-85 years |
| Underwriting Speed | 2-4 weeks | 24-48 hours accelerated |
